Rickmers Maritime winds up operations
The Singapore-based containership lessor, which has a fleet of 14 Panamax ships, said it will wind up operations in the wake of defaulting on loans.

AP: FRA finds thousands of safety defects on crude routes
Federal Railroad Administration inspectors have discovered nearly 24,000 defects, including worn rails, broken or loose bolts, and cracked steel bars on rail lines used to transport crude oil, according to a report from the Associated Press.
China Merchants completes Sinotrans takeover
Sinotrans & CSC, parent company of the largest freight forwarder in China, has become a wholly-owned subsidiary of transportation, finance and real estate conglomerate China Merchants Group.

MPC Capital launches niche boxship investment fund in Germany
The independent investment and asset management firm is launching MPC Container Ships AS, an investment vehicle focused on feeder vessels with between 1,000 TEUs and 3,000 TEUs of capacity, the company said in a statement.
